Medicine is the art and science of healing. It encompasses a range of health care practices evolved to maintain and restore health by the prevention and treatment of illness.

Contemporary medicine applies health science, biomedical research, and medical technology to diagnose and treat injury and disease, typically through medication, surgery, or some other form of therapy. The word medicine is derived from the Latin ars medicina, meaning the art of healing.

Though medical technology and clinical expertise are pivotal to contemporary medicine, successful face-to-face relief of actual suffering continues to require the application of ordinary human feeling and compassion, known in English as bedside manner.

Where can I find a medicine which will help to reduce the side effect suffer from chemotherapy surgery?
Q. I am looking for a medicine which will help to reduce the side effect suffer from chemotherapy surgery. The doctor told me the medicine contains "L-Glutamine" and it is made by "Cambridge Nutraceuticals company". However, I couldn't find it anyway. Anyone know where I can buy it? Online or in-store all fine.
Asked by TeChen H - Tue Jul 8 13:08:58 2008 - - 4 Answers - 0 Comments

A. You can buy it at most vitamin stores or body building supply shops. Ask for L- Glutamine itself. My wife took it during chemo. It is best and more economical to buy it in powder form and without any other additives. Don't just buy a general supplement with some L-Glutamine in it. It is made by more than one company. You just mix the powder up with water or I guess milk if you want. Add some real vanilla extract if you want to improve the flavour as it doesn't have much taste.
